Extended-range electric vehicle with supercapacitor range extender

1. A powertrain for a vehicle having an engine, comprising:

  • an electric traction motor having an output shaft;

    a rechargeable battery pack;

    a supercapacitor module that is electrically connected to the battery pack; and

    first and second clutches having, at all times, opposite apply states, wherein the first clutch, when applied, connects the traction motor to the engine to thereby establish a neutral-charging mode, and wherein the second clutch, when applied, connects the output shaft to a drive axle to establish a drive mode;

    wherein the drive mode uses energy from the supercapacitor module and the battery pack to power the traction motor and the neutral-charging mode uses output torque from the engine to charge the supercapacitor module and the battery pack.
